Net Revenue Retention (NRR)

The percentage of recurring revenue retained from existing customers after accounting for upgrades, downgrades, and churn.

NRR above 100% means your existing customer base is growing without any new acquisitions — the hallmark of a best-in-class SaaS company. Companies like Snowflake and Datadog have achieved NRR above 130%. It is calculated as (Starting MRR + Expansion - Contraction - Churn) / Starting MRR.
